Investing in Social Change
Susan Meeker Lowry and Paula Mannillo
Friday, 25 Sep 1987 at 12:00 am – Sun Room, Memorial Union
Susan Meeker-Lowry is the President of Catalyst Publications and Editor of the newsletter "Catalyst, Investing in Social Change." Paula Mannillo is Director of Finance for Women's Economic Development Corporation in St. Paul.
